Post by: Troll123 on February 12, 2003, 03:38:00 AM
I'm very interested to see the progress on whatever the winamp dev is going to do...

Also streaming an ISO game from a server is VERY unlikely because once you start the game you lose the connection to the streaming server. Can't run more than one xbe at a time on the xbox. If this were going to be possible it would have to be done in the bios.

TS is not essentially MPG.

You can encapsulate services in a TS, and those services may or may not carry video and/or audio on PIDs. These PIDs may or may not be encoded in MPG. You can carry anything in a TS. At work I write code to carry IP streams (carousels, streaming video (mpeg4, divx, etc.) inside a TS PID ;-)

Depending on your platform (ATSC or DVB), you have either 188-byte or 204-byte packets to work with in the TS PID stream. You can pack anything into these (within common sense/reason).
